Boolean algebra does not account for propagation delays through signal paths of actually circuits. The delay can cause glitches to occur. A glitch is an unwanted signal, usually a short pulse caused by the transient behavior of signal path that have different delays A hazard exists any time the potential for glitches is present. Glitches may not be a problem or they may create havoc. It depends on the specific application. Hazard

Static hazard A static-1 hazard exists when an output variable should be a logic 1, but goes to 0 momentarily as a result of input variable changing. A static-0 hazard exists when an output variable should be a logic 0, but goes to 1 momentarily as a result of input variable changing
